REQUIREMENTS

We are looking for active Co-op members who are committed to Durham to represent our owners and help guide our future and influence. We want our board to be built by people who are passionate about sustainable food and willing to learn about business, financials, and cooperative grocery models. Candidates need to be able to make a 3-year commitment to the board, willing to sign a conflict of interest disclosure form, and attend at least one board meeting in order to run (view board meeting schedule HERE or contact the board at annualmeeting@durham.coop). Board responsibilities include attendance at regularly scheduled board meetings (the 2nd Wednesday of every month), service on committees as needed, and participation in occasional off-site retreats and store events. Average monthly time commitment ranges from 3 to 8 hours.

ABOUT THE BOARD

The Co-op is governed by the board, and everyone on the board is a community member or staff member and a Co-op owner. Anyone who is an owner can run for the board, and every owner gets to vote for board members each year. The board of directors consists of consumer-owners and worker-owners. Board members are committed to representing nearly 7000 Co-op consumer- and worker-owners and voicing the values and goals of Co-op members.

The main responsibilities of the board involve setting the goals and values of the Co-op (read about our values HERE), as well as hiring, evaluating, and holding the General Manager accountable for the overall success of the Co-op.
